Default RE: THE Sturgis sues Little Sturgis

If the two places weren't 1800 miles apart I might say they had a leg to stand on, but come on. It's just not realistic for some people to take the time off work and ride or transport their bikes that far and pay over priced hotel and food for an entire week. Some folks are doing really good justto have a motorcycle at all,not to mention thosewho are really lucky and have a Harley. Little Sturgis is a lot more feasible destination for anyone living in this region so a few (20k vs 500k+) get together and party in the name of the freedom that the original rally signifies. It's not like the half million people who show up and few million others who wanted to go but couldn't are suddenly goingstop going to the realrally and come to Kentucky instead. I rode through Sturgis, ND the last day of the rally a few years and I can see where that's the only thing the place has going for it. I bet most people who live near there hate the rally but they're not going to give up that money, they'll suck it up - and sue if they have to. Plus, how many more people could they pack into a dinky little place like that anyway?
